As of Apr 2025, the median cost of dog boarding in Culver City is $63 per night, including service fees. Boarding your dog for one week typically costs $441. Sitters on Rover set their own rates based on their qualifications, your dog's needs, and their space's amenities. As a result, most Culver City dog boarding rates can be found as low as $34 to as high as $89 per night.
As of Apr 2025, 8,500 sitters provided dog boarding in Culver City. You can filter, sort, expand your radius, read reviews, and compare pricing to find the perfect sitter near you. As a reminder, dog boarding sitters joining Rover must pass a background check for you and your dog’s safety.
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ple sitters about your booking. Typically, 89% of Culver City dog boarding sitters respond in under an hour.
Sitters who provide dog boarding in Culver City have an average of 15 years of experience. Dog boarding sitters with repeat customers have an average of 10 repeat clients. Experience can vary from sitter to sitter, but you can view reviews, years of experience, and number of repeat clients when you compare sitters in Culver City.
